Emergency measure - Eyes: Immediately irrigate with eyewash solution or clean
water,holding the eyelids apart, for at least 10 minutes.
Obtain medical attention.
Emergency measure - Skin: Remove contaminated clothing. After contact with skin, wash
immediately with plenty of water. If symptoms (irritation
or blistering) occur obtain medical attention.
Emergency measure - Ingestion: Wash out mouth with water and give 200-300ml of water to
drink. Do not induce vomiting as a First-Aid measure.
Obtain immediate medical attention.
Fire-fighting measures
Protective equipment: A self contained breathing apparatus and suitable protective
clothing should be worn in fire conditions.

- Transport code: UN No 2811
Transport: ICAI/IATA
UN No : 2811
Proper Shipping Name : TOXIC SOLID, ORGANIC, N.O.S.
(ISOPROPYL-8-AMINO-2,3-DIMETHYLIMIDAZO-(1,2-A)-PYRIDINE-6-
CARBOXYLATE HYDROBROMIDE)
Class : 6.1
Packing Group : III
Air Pack Instruction
Passenger/Cargo : 619
Air Pack Instruction
Cargo Only : 619
Emergency Response : 6L
Guidance Code
IMO/IMDG
UN No. : 2811
Proper Shipping Name : TOXIC SOLID, ORGANIC,N.O.S.
(ISOPROPYL-8-AMINO-2,3-DIMETHYLIMIDAZO-(1,2-A)-PYRIDINE-6-
CARBOXYLATE HYDROBROMIDE)
Class : 6.1
Marine Pollutant : Not classified as a Marine Pollutant
Packing Group : III
Packing Instruction : P002
EMS Number : F-A, S-A
ADR
UN No. 2811
Proper Shipping Name : TOXIC SOLID, ORGANIC,N.O.S.
(ISOPROPYL-8-AMINO-2,3-DIMETHYLIMIDAZO-(1,2-A)-PYRIDINE-6-
CARBOXYLATE HYDROBROMIDE)
Class : 6.1
Label(s): 6.1
Classification Code : T2
Packing Group : III
Packing Instruction : P002
HIN : 60

Disposal considerations
Industry - Possibility of neutralisation: Not recommended.
Industry - Possibility of destruction: controlled discharge: Disposal should be in accordance with local, state or
national legislation.
Industry - Possibility of destruction - incineration: Dispose by incineration above 1100 deg C with waste gas
treatment.
